In meditating on my prior post today, “In Order To Not Be Judged“, I came up with a challenge for myself that I think could be ultimately helpful for anyone to undertake. I began thinking of all the things I have done, and decisions I have made in my life, based on the fear of being judged … or the desire to gain approval (the flip side of that same coin).
As I allowed the mental chatter in my brain to die down I started working it through; using the following line to begin each new sentence:
“In order to not be judged I have …”
The challenge, should you choose to accept and participate, is to go back through your life … even all the way back to when you were a child … and think of how many ways you have acted based on the desire to either not be judged, or to gain acceptance. Some of the instances are insignificant, I found for myself … and others were completely life altering in scope.
What is the reason for this? Well, you cannot let anything go in your life, without first acknowledging its existence. If you are not aware of it, how can it be released? Acknowledge, Accept, Let Go, and Move Forward as your True Self … that is the process that has been revolutionary for me in my own life.
Being a singer/songwriter … if I repeat ANYTHING for a long enough period of time I will find some sort of rhythm and tune to put it into ;-). So, after spending enough time in meditative thought (about a half hour or so), I began writing down my list in the form of a song. Pardon the poetic simplicity … I heard it as a rock song in my head and so I just allowed the melody in my head to bring out the fitting words rhythmically in line with what I was hearing.
Here is my own endeavor into this challenge … in the form of a new song:
